What are the responsibilities and job description for the Inventory Coordinator position at In Place?
In Place is looking for someone who is highly organized and has a strong attention to detail. This person will be command central and will be responsible for bridging all divisions within the company. This flexible part-time position has the potential to become full-time for the right candidate.
RESPONSIBILITIES
Logistics
- Ordering, entering, and tracking of orders and deliveries for both projects as well as our retail space.
- Coordinating and overseeing receiving, deliveries and installations
- Communicating pricing and freight costs to team members
- Quality control – handle and communicate any damages or delays to project managers
- Assist with Vendor relationships and representatives
- Track budgets and deliver invoices and information to the bookkeeper to ensure on-time billing
Project Coordination
- Work with project managers to meet timelines and budgets
- Enter and manage specifications, selections, and product details to ensure information is organized and available to the team and project partners
QUALIFICATIONS
- Previous administrative experience
- Effective communication skills, both written and verbal
- Enthusiastic, eager to learn, and a team player
- Strong organizational skills and attention to detail
- Experience in construction, interior design, marketing or retail is a plus
